WAXY adjective

Definition of waxy (adjective)

  1. made of or covered with wax
    • "waxen candles"; "careful, the floor is waxy"
    • synonyms: waxen
  2. easily impressed or influenced
  3. capable of being bent or flexed or twisted without breaking
  4. having the paleness of wax
    • "the poor face with the same awful waxen pallor"- Bram Stoker; "the soldier turned his waxlike features toward him"; "a thin face with a waxy paleness"
    • synonyms: waxen, waxlike
